Meeting Point and Logistics

Reykjavik: Whale Watching by RIB Speedboat - Meeting Point and Logistics

Check-in is required 30 minutes before departure at Old Harbour House, located at Aegisgardur 2, 101 Reykjavik. This central meeting point is easy to find, making it convenient for participants.

There’s nearby free parking, so you won’t have to worry about where to leave your car. Upon arrival, guests can use a self-service kiosk to scan their tickets, streamlining the check-in process.

It’s a good idea to arrive early, giving you time to settle in and soak up the atmosphere of the harbor. With everything in place, participants can look forward to a thrilling whale watching adventure that’s just around the corner.

Don’t forget to dress warmly; it can get chilly out on the water!

Safety and Restrictions

Reykjavik: Whale Watching by RIB Speedboat - Safety and Restrictions

Once guests are checked in and ready for their adventure, it’s important to understand the safety measures and restrictions in place to ensure everyone has a safe and enjoyable experience on the water.

The tour operators prioritize safety, so here are some key points to keep in mind:

  1. Safety equipment, including warm overalls, gloves, and goggles, is provided for all guests.

  2. Children under 10, pregnant women, and anyone with back problems can’t participate.

  3. Guests must be at least 4 ft 8 in (145 cm) tall to join the tour.

  4. It’s recommended to dress warmly, as weather conditions can change rapidly on the water.

Is There a Specific Season That’s Best for Whale Watching in Reykjavik?

The best time for whale watching in Reykjavik is during summer months, particularly from June to August. During this season, warmer waters attract various species, increasing the chances of spotting whales and other marine life.
